A field experiment was conducted at the research farm of the Department of Agronomy, Bangabandhu Sheikh Mujibur Rahman Agricultural University, Gazipur, from November 2011 to May 2012 to find out the growth pattern and optimum sowing date of tropical sugar beet in Bangladesh. The tropical sugar beet genotypes were Cauvery, Shubhra and EB0616, and sowing dates were 01 November, 15 November, 01 December and 15 December. The interaction effect of sowing dates and sugar beet genotypes was statistically significant in growth parameters like leave number, leaf area index (LAI), crop growth rate (CGR), root weight per plant, root yield. The highest root yield was obtained from genotypes EB0616 when sown on 01 November (103.5 t/ha) and 15 November (100 t/ha). The genotypes Cauvery and Shubhra gave identical root yield i.e., 90.27 t/ha and 92.86 t/ha, respectively on 01 November sowing. Root yield significantly decreased in all the three genotypes with the advancement of sowing dates from 01 November onwards. For high root yield the optimum sowing date for tropical sugar beet in Bangladesh seems to be in early November.

To find out the optimum sowing time and growth pattern of tropical sugar beet in Bangladesh.

Site, design and crop husbandry - The trial was conducted during 2011 to 2012 in the experimental field of the Bangabandhu Sheikh Mujibur Rahman Agricultural University, Gazipur Bangladesh. The experiment was laid out in Randomized Complete Block Design (RCBD) having two factors with three replications. Since the pH of the experimental field was 5.7, therefore, dolomite was applied @ 1500kg/ha to raise the soil pH. Therefore, the final pH of the soil was 7.2. Seeds of three tropical sugar beet genotypes were sown on four different dates at 15 days interval starting from 1st November 2011 maintaining 50× 20 cm spacing in 3×2 m2 unit plot. During final land preparation cow dung @ 15 t ha-1 was incorporated into the soil. A fertilizer dose of 120 kg N, 105 kg P2O5, 150 kg K2O, 18 kg S, 3.5 kg Zn and 1.2 kg B ha-1 was applied in the form of urea, TSP, MoP, ZnSO4 and boric acid, respectively. One third of the total urea and all other fertilizers were applied during final land preparation. The remaining amount of urea was applied as top dressing in two equal installments at 60 and 100 days after sowing (DAS). The field was kept weed free by hand weeding at 20, 40 and 60 DAS. Plant was thinned out keeping one plant per hill during the second weeding. Irrigation frequency was enough to prevent significant plant water stress. Plants were infected by damping off disease at seedling stage, and sclerotium root rot at seedling and later stages of growth. These were controlled by applying Dithane M 45 @ 2.2 kg ha-1 at seedling stage, and at later stage by applying Score 250 EC 0.5 ml/L of water. Data collection - Out of the 6 m2 of unit plot 2 m2 was kept in each plot for final harvest to estimate the root yield and from the remaining 4 m2 of land three plants were randomly selected from each plot at 30, 60, 90, 120, 150 and 165 days after emergence (DAE) according to sowing dates for recording number of leaves, leaf area index, dry matter and crop growth rate. Total number of fully developed green leaves was counted in three plants at each sampling and averaged to per plant. The leaf area was measured with an automatic leaf area meter (Model: Li- 3100C). The crop growth rate (CGR) was calculated by the following formula as described by Grander et al.. CGR = [1/GA x (W2 - W1)/(T2 - T1)] gm-1day-1 Where, W1 = dry weight at time T1 (g), W2 = dry weight at time T2 (g) and GA = ground area (m2) Based on sowing dates, plants were harvested at 165 DAE from 2 m2 of land from each plot and their root yield was calculated to kg m-2 and t ha-1. The data were subjected to the combined analysis of variance and LSD test was used for means separation by using the MSTAT-C statistical software. Air temperature during experimental period was recorded.

From the results of the present study it may be concluded that the tropical sugar beet genotypes viz. Cauvery, Shabhra and EB0616 can be grown under Bangladesh agro-ecological conditions. For high root and sucrose yield the optimum sowing date for tropical sugar beet genotypes in Bangladesh seems to be early November.
